What Are Hyper-Realistic Robots and Why Are They Gaining Popularity?
Hyper-realistic robots are machines designed to closely resemble humans in appearance and behavior. They feature lifelike skin textures, facial expressions, and even minute details like body hair. More importantly, they incorporate advanced technologies such as voice recognition, facial recognition, and emotion detection, enabling natural conversations, emotional understanding, and personalized services.
The market appeal of these robots stems from several factors:
- Emotional needs: In our fast-paced society, many experience loneliness and stress. These robots can provide companionship and psychological support.
- Functional needs: They serve as domestic assistants for household tasks and elderly/child care.
- Educational applications: In learning environments, they offer personalized educational experiences.
- Commercial uses: They enhance brand image and service efficiency in customer service and product demonstrations.
Three Key Advantages of Hyper-Realistic Robots
The market success of these robots rests on three primary advantages:
1. Uncanny Human-Like Appearance: With meticulously crafted facial features, realistic skin textures, and human-like expressions, these robots create an emotional connection that transcends typical machine interactions.
2. Advanced Interactive Capabilities: Equipped with cutting-edge voice recognition and natural language processing, these robots engage in fluid conversations, understand user intent, and respond appropriately to emotional cues - transforming them from mere tools into companion-like entities.
3. Versatile Functionality: Their applications span multiple domains: domestic assistance, eldercare, childcare, personalized education, and commercial customer service. This multifunctionality significantly enhances their practical value.
Strategies for Cross-Border E-Commerce Sellers
For cross-border sellers, this emerging market represents a significant opportunity. Key strategies include:
Platform Selection: Different marketplaces cater to distinct demographics. Amazon suits mass-market products, while specialized platforms may better serve premium custom solutions.
Precise Market Positioning: Understanding customer motivations - whether for companionship, domestic assistance, or commercial use - is crucial for effective product positioning and marketing.
Brand Development: High-quality product images, detailed descriptions, and professional customer service build trust and purchase intent. Managing customer reviews and promptly addressing concerns maintains brand reputation.
Multichannel Marketing: Beyond marketplace listings, leverage social media, content marketing, and influencer collaborations. Product demonstration videos on YouTube or user experience posts on Instagram can effectively expand reach.
